Job Description:
Responsibilities will include analyzing drawings for weight and inertial properties by examining the applicable drawings and part lists and creating and analyzing solid models in CATIA V4/V5. It will also be necessary for the engineer to analyze the generated data using proprietary tools to determine how the changes will affect the overall weight and center of gravity of the aircraft by examining the relevant engineering changes and how they interact with current standard aircraft and provide detailed reports on these changes regularly. Successful candidates will be required to complete a comprehensive schedule of training in the required tools and applications.
Requirements:
Bachelors Degree or equivalent in Mechanical or Aerospace Engineering with a preference for a Masters or equivalent.
2 years of engineering experience with Bachelors or 1 year experience with Masters in Mechanical or Aerospace Engineering
Proficiency using CATIA V4 and/or V5 (at least 40 hours of training and 100 hours of practical use) with a preference for VPM Proficiency.
Ability to read engineering drawings and part lists.
Proficiency in using the UNIX operating system.
Basic Proficiency using Microsoft Office tools such as Word and Excel and exc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Preferably experienced with Object-Oriented Programming and relational databases
Preferably able to support engineering process improvements
Ability to think critically and pay particular attention to detail.
Ability to work with a minimum of supervision.
